IN MY roles as Labour Leader of City of York Council and as a councillor for Holgate Ward, I receive a number of letters about pertinent issues from residents.
Today I have received a second letter regarding a ward issue and the resident has stated that I have done nothing whatsoever about the first letter and that if I do not act on the second letter within ten days he will go to local MPs and the media.
I would like to contact the resident about their issue, but there are no contact details included.
Can I request that if residents want a response they please include their name and address? I have many skills but being psychic is not one of them.
Coun James Alexander, Labour Leader of City of York Council.
